Training and development definition

Training and development refers to educational activities within a company created to enhance the knowledge and skills of employees while providing information and instruction on how to better perform specific tasks.

Difference between training and development

Training is a short-term reactive process meant for operatives and process while development is designed continuous pro-active process meant for executives. In training employees’ aim is to develop additional skills and in development, it is to develop a total personality.

In training, the initiative is taken by the management with the objective of meeting the present need o fan employee. In development, initiative is taken by the individual with the objective to meet the future need o fan employee.

Importance of training and development

• Offers optimum utilization of Human resources

• Enhances skill development

• Increases productivity

• Improves organizational culture

• Improve quality and safety

• Increase profitability

• Improves the company’s morale and corporate image

Advantages and disadvantages of training and development

Advantages:

1. Helps employees develop new skills and increases their knowledge.

2. Improves efficiency and productivity of individuals and teams.

3. Creates new and improved job positions.

4. Keeps employees motivated and enhance contribution levels.

Disadvantages:

1. It is a relatively expensive process.

2. There is a risk that after the training and development session, the employee can quit the job.
